Section 124.20 - Classification rules - record keeping.

Ohio Rev Code § 124.20 (2015) What's This?

The director of administrative services, with the approval of the state personnel board of review, shall adopt rules:

(A) For appointment, promotions, transfers, layoffs, suspensions, reductions, reinstatements, and removals in and examinations and registrations for offices and positions in the civil service of the state. Appointing authorities with officers or employees in the civil service of the state shall submit personnel action information to the department of administrative services as the director requires.

(B) For maintaining and keeping records of the efficiency of officers and employees in the civil service of the state in accordance with sections 124.01 to 124.64 of the Revised Code.

Due notice of the contents of those rules and of all changes shall be given to appointing authorities affected by those rules, and those rules also shall be available for public distribution.
